The Adventure of Pinocchio
Description
Pinocchio, a taper-nosed Pierrot, who is vacillating between hope and delusion as he rushes headlong from one bad decision to the next, has one major desire and that is to become a real boy someday. In order to accomplish this goal he has to learn to act responsibly.
